Lenny, there are quite a few soup recipes in the low carb recipes folder, also have you tried wiflib's leek and chicken soup??
You can also make a chicken noodle soup = chicken bouillon, add chunky low carb veggies, chicken cut into chunks and just before serving add shirataki noodles (you can now buy them from H&B as well, so thats handy for some)

You can make comforting, creamy soups, eg courgette soup, just fry chopped onion in some butter, add sliced courgettes, salt, pepper, herbs, bouillon powder, a little bit of water, simmer for 10 mins, then puree with stick blender, add cream and its ready - you can do this with other veggies too, eg cauliflower, broccoli, or mixed veggies, throw in a carrot, just one wont make you spike, then puree but leave a few chunks and there you have a perfect wholesome thick veetable soup, a little curry powder or Magi liquid seasoning addes is nice as well.
